Research on the Integration of High School Human Geography Curriculum and Ideological and Political Education Based on the Concepts of Sustainable Development
Sustainable development education is a crucial component of geography education and contains rich elements of political thinking.Geography teaching based on the concepts of sustainable development can better utilize the function of ideological and political education in geography courses.The strategy of sustainable development,which contains a wealth of material for the education of ideology and sustainable development,is an important carrier for the country to practice its sustainable concepts.Applying it to human geography teaching in high school can help students generate the concepts of sustainable development and implement the ideological and political goals of geography curriculum.Therefore,this paper attempts to explore the connection between the sustainable development strategy"China·s Agenda 21"and high school human geography curriculum on goals and contents level,and it proposes the teaching methods for infiltrating the ideological and political education into high school human geography curriculum from the perspective of the sustainable development strategy.By designing geography contexts based on the sustainable development strategy,students'emotional resonance are evoked,by setting geography learning questions in combination with the sustainable development strategy,students are helped to internalize them,and by carrying out geography activities which are related to sustainable development,students'perceptual understanding are enhanced.
